Nikon Nikkor Z 85 mm f/1.8 S Lens for Nikon Z

Its 85mm f/1.8 prime design delivers excellent sharpness and beautiful background blur for portrait work. The lens is also well-regarded for its solid build quality and optical performance within its price segment. This lens is best for portrait photographers seeking a dedicated, high-quality prime lens for Nikon Z-mount cameras.
Laowa Venus Optics Laowa 9mm f/2.8 Zero-D Lens for Nikon

Its 9mm focal length and rectilinear "Zero-D" design deliver an extremely wide field of view with remarkably low distortion for architectural or interior photography. The lens is exceptionally compact and light at just 215g, making it a highly portable option for APS-C Nikon Z cameras. This manual focus prime is best suited for landscape and real estate photographers who prioritize minimal geometric distortion in a lightweight, ultra-wide package.
Tamron 18-300mm f/3.5-6.3 Di III-A VC VXD Lens

Its 18-300mm focal range offers a versatile 16.6x zoom in a relatively compact 621g package, paired with effective Vibration Compensation (VC) stabilization. The lens stands out with its 1:2 maximum magnification ratio, providing surprisingly strong close-up capability for an all-in-one zoom. This makes it an ideal single-lens solution for travel photographers and hobbyists who want to capture everything from landscapes to distant wildlife without changing gear.
